logo

Output 84ea50629f227968375ca3f46a5f50ff03a9443241221e20d679bbfa468945de:1

value
3967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 856dc7209a8abc2a04956db7b44e2c4cfea4bcdc OP_EQUAL
address
3DrXJZANrHnL6R48tSfRir4eEehAm4tLMm
transaction
84ea50629f227968375ca3f46a5f50ff03a9443241221e20d679bbfa468945de